For those with a soldering iron I can recommend mintyboost [1]
Works great here, two AA batteries extend the life of the Neo for about
two hours.
As it is a dumb charger you need to manually activate fast charge,
otherwise the Neo will only pull 100mA.
Make sure you test the output voltage
